Coin ATM Radar: the number of installed crypto ATMs exceeds 11.6 thousand

The number of ATMs that can be used to carry out operations with cryptocurrency is constantly increasing, states the Coin ATM Radar service. Since the beginning of this year, the growth has been 83%.

It is noted that the installation of new equipment per day exceeds 20 units and has already reached 11689. It should be noted that in January this figure was in the region of 6370 units. The leaders are Genesis Coin and General Bytes, with market shares of 36% and 29.5%, respectively.

At the moment, residents of 70 countries can use cryptomats. Most of them are located in the USA, Great Britain and Canada.
